1. Dump Sewer and Grey Water before returning coach or there will be a $80 fee applied.
2. Do not take rv off road it must be kept on maintained road or on a maintained dirt road must be kept on maintained roads at all times.
3. Move driver seat forward to clear slide before opening or closing slide or it will crush driver chair.
4. Sweep and clean any rocks or debris or anything off of the floors before opening and closing slide any debris or rocks left on floor will scratch and damage the new floors.
5. Keep track of your sewage and grey water levels by using the digital gauge on the wall located by the restroom or by checking the toilet visually and make sure it doesn't overflow.
6. Make sure and double check all storage compartments are tightly closed and secure so they do not open when driving, make sure both slides are closed 100% of the way and the stairs for the door are not sticking out and are stowed away properly before driving the coach each time, also make sure the awning is closed and secured.
7. Generator will not start if there is less than 1/4 tank of fuel left.
